> There are a number of new SECURITY properties in ConfigurationProperties that have a "geode 1.0" tag that have inadequate javadocs. This is the primary location for documenting distribution config properties, so they need to have a good description like all of the other properties.
> This is one such property:
> {noformat}
> /**
> * The static String definition of the <i>"security-manager"</i>
> * property
> * @since Geode 1.0
> */
> String SECURITY_MANAGER = SECURITY_PREFIX + "manager";
> {noformat}
> this is a properly documented property:
> {noformat}
> /**
> * The static String definition of the <i>"remote-locators"</i> property
> * <a name="remote-locators"/a><p>
> * <U>Description</U>: A list of locators (host and port) that a cluster
> * will use in order to connect to a remote site in a multi-site (WAN)
> * configuration. This attribute's value is a possibly comma separated list.
> * <p>For each remote locator, provide a hostname and/or address
> * (separated by '@', if you use both), followed by a port number in brackets.
> * <p>Examples:
> * remote-locators=address1[port1],address2[port2]
> * <p>
> * remote-locators=hostName1@address1[port1],hostName2@address2[port2]
> * <p>
> * remote-locators=hostName1[port1],hostName2[port2]<p>
> * <p>
> * <U>Default</U>: ""
> */
> String REMOTE_LOCATORS = "remote-locators";
> {noformat}
